$1 Million to establish the Olga Tennison Autism Research Centre (OTARC)
One in 100 children are affected by an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D). For grandmother Olga Tennison, her beloved grandson was that one. She wanted answers on what could be done to help her grandson.
Olga's questioning led to her making a significant $1mil leading gift in 2008 to establish Olga Tennison Autism Research Centre (OTARC), Australia's first centre dedicated to ASD research.
